What to Expect During the Day

Puerto Vallarta: Majahuitas Island Pirate Ship Tour - What to Expect During the Day

The Pirate Show and Entertainment

Once anchored at Majahuitas, the fun is just beginning. The pirate show is quite the highlight, with performances that include swordfights, singing, and interactive segments where the audience gets involved. According to some reviews, the crew’s enthusiasm is contagious, and even skeptical travelers found themselves caught up in the revelry. It’s lively, colorful, and designed to entertain all ages.

Beach Activities at Majahuitas

Majahuitas Beach itself is a pristine spot. Here, you’ll find plenty of activities: snorkeling gear is provided, and the clear waters make for an enjoyable swim. Kayaks are available if you want to paddle around, and some guests mentioned that the banana boat rides are a hit with kids and adults alike. While soaking up the sun, you’ll appreciate the bar onboard serving cold beer and soft drinks, plus unlimited drinks from the all-you-can-drink open bar.

Lunch Options and Dining Experience

Food is an integral part of this tour, and the lunch options are quite generous. The BASIC MENU offers eight different choices, while the PREMIUM MENU includes even more indulgent options like lobster tail and whisky. Reviewers note that the food is generally tasty and well-prepared, and the variety caters well to different tastes.

Additional Activities

After lunch, activities continue with kids’ games, a treasure hunt, and the chance to purchase souvenirs or photos of your day. The DVD of your tour is available to buy, which can be a fun keepsake. Many guests appreciated the chance to relax, take photos, and enjoy the surroundings.

FAQ

Puerto Vallarta: Majahuitas Island Pirate Ship Tour - FAQ

Is the tour suitable for children?
Yes, many reviews mention kids’ activities and a treasure hunt, making it family-friendly. The lively pirate show is designed to entertain all ages.

What kind of food is included?
A full hot-cooked breakfast and a hot lunch are provided. The lunch options include a basic menu with eight choices and a premium menu with options like lobster tail and whisky.

Are drinks included?
Yes, there’s an all-you-can-drink open bar, featuring beer, soft drinks, and other beverages.

How long is the tour?
The entire experience lasts about 6 hours, usually in the morning, giving you plenty of time for activities and relaxation.

What activities are available at Majahuitas Beach?
Snorkeling, kayaking, banana boat rides, and beach lounging are the main options. Equipment is provided.

Is the tour rated well?
Yes, the provider has a 4.4-star rating, indicating most guests were satisfied with their experience.

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und.

Do I need to bring anything?
Sun protection and swimwear are recommended. Photos and DVDs can be purchased if you want a keepsake of your day.

Is this tour good for solo travelers?
While it’s family-oriented and lively, solo travelers who enjoy social, active experiences usually enjoy the communal atmosphere.

What language are the guides?
Guides speak both English and Spanish, ensuring clear communication for most travelers.
